第1题
A.用于实现互斥作用的信号量初值为0
B.信号量值的变化一般只受wait和signal原语操作的影响而不是随意的程序语句
C.Signal操作会使相应信号量的值增长
D.信号量的初值根据不同的同步控制情况取值不同
第3题
A.在不同信号量上调用P操作
B.在同一信号量上调用P操作
C.在不同信号量上调用V操作
D.在同一信号量上调用V操作
第4题
用PV操作管理这些并发进程时,应怎样定义信号量,写出信号量的初值以及信号量各
种取值的含义。
(2)根据所定义的信号量,把应执行的PV操作填入下述括号中,以保证进程能够正确地并发执行。
COBEGINGP POCESS Pi(i=1,2,……)
begin;
(A )
进入博物馆;
游览;
退出;
(B )
end;
COEND
(3)游客最多为N人,写出信号量可能的变化范围(最大值和最小值)。
第5题
A.P操作和V操作均是原子操作
B.P(S)操作的特点是:如果S<=0条件下执行P操作,必会陷入“忙等”
C.在一个信号量S上可以同时执行多个P(S)操作
D.P(S)和V(S)必须成对地出现
第6题
A.≤0
B.>0
C.≥0
D.<0
第7题
A.该单缓冲区
B.两进程的临界区
C.两进程的程序段
D.两进程的控制块
为了保护您的账号安全,请在“上学吧”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!